2. Cambly

Best for: Beginners who want flexible speaking practice with native speakers

Cambly is one of the most accessible platforms for English learners. With a simple app and instant connection to native-speaking tutors, it allows students to practice anytime. Beginners who need to build confidence in speaking will find Cambly convenient and welcoming.

Key Features

  • Instant 1-on-1 Video Chats: No booking required—students can start lessons immediately.

  • Global Tutors: Choose from thousands of native speakers with various accents.

  • Lesson Recordings: Every session is recorded so learners can review pronunciation and mistakes later.

  • Beginner-Friendly Filters: You can select tutors experienced with first-time English learners.

Why It’s Great for Beginners

Cambly is perfect for those who want to get used to hearing native accents early. Although it doesn’t have a strict curriculum, the casual learning style helps shy learners speak naturally.

Tip: Beginners should start with 15-minute daily sessions to avoid fatigue and focus on simple topics like self-introduction and daily routines.


3. Preply

Best for: Learners who want to find a tutor that matches their learning goals and budget

Preply is a tutor marketplace that connects students with certified English teachers worldwide. Beginners can easily find tutors who specialize in foundational grammar, pronunciation, or conversational basics.

Key Features

  • Customizable Learning Path: Each tutor designs lessons based on your level and interests.

  • Tutor Matching System: You can browse profiles, watch introduction videos, and choose based on teaching style.

  • Affordable Options: Lessons start as low as $5, making it accessible for students with tight budgets.

  • Trial Lessons Available: Test a tutor before committing to regular classes.

Why It Works for Beginners

Unlike automated apps, Preply focuses on human interaction. Beginners can learn basic grammar and pronunciation in a supportive 1-on-1 setting. The flexibility to choose tutors from the Philippines or other countries helps learners find accents and styles they are comfortable with.

Bonus: Many Filipino tutors on Preply are experienced with beginner-level students, offering a balance of patience and clear explanations.


4. Engoo

Best for: Students who want structured daily English practice with professional tutors

Engoo (formerly known as DMM English) is one of the most popular platforms in Asia, especially among Japanese and Korean learners. It’s known for its easy-to-use platform, affordable pricing, and diverse tutors.

Key Features

  • Daily Lesson Option: 25-minute daily sessions encourage consistent practice.

  • Wide Range of Tutors: Choose between native and non-native English speakers.

  • Free Learning Materials: Access hundreds of beginner lessons covering everyday English, travel phrases, and grammar basics.

  • Progress Tracking: View detailed learning history and lesson notes online.

Why Beginners Love It

Engoo’s lessons are structured enough for total beginners but flexible enough to include free talk sessions. The combination of affordable pricing and well-designed materials makes it a solid choice for those starting their English journey.

Pro Tip: Beginners should start with the “Daily News (Easy)” or “Beginner Conversation” materials for balanced listening and speaking improvement.


5. Lingoda

Best for: Learners who prefer small-group lessons with certified teachers

Lingoda offers a more classroom-like online learning experience with live group sessions. It’s a great option for beginners who learn better in small group settings and want more structured progression.

Key Features

  • Small Group Classes (3–5 Students): Learn with peers and interact in real time.

  • CEFR-Aligned Curriculum: Lessons follow the European standard framework (A1–C2), ensuring clear progress from beginner to advanced levels.

  • Native and Certified Teachers: Tutors are professional educators experienced with teaching English as a second language.

  • Flexible Scheduling: Classes are available 24/7 to fit any time zone.

Why It’s Beginner-Friendly

Beginners who prefer a structured course and social learning environment will find Lingoda ideal. The clear course path helps students build confidence steadily without feeling lost.

Special Feature: Lingoda’s “Language Sprint” challenges motivate beginners to stay consistent for 2–3 months, leading to noticeable improvement.

Additional Tips for Beginner English Learners

1. Start Small but Consistent

You don’t need to study for hours each day. Even 20–30 minutes daily builds strong habits.

2. Focus on Pronunciation Early

Many beginners skip pronunciation, but learning to speak clearly from the start prevents bad habits later.

3. Record Yourself Speaking

Listening to your own voice helps you notice pronunciation and fluency progress.

4. Don’t Fear Mistakes

Making errors is natural—and teachers expect them. What matters most is communicating ideas, not perfection.

5. Mix Real-Life English

Watch short YouTube videos, follow English social media, or change your phone’s language setting to English for daily exposure.
